What We Like
+Exceptional build quality with premium all-metal construction and attention to detail reminiscent of vintage lenses
+Fast f/1.4 aperture with 14 aperture blades produces smooth, creamy bokeh and excellent low-light performance
+Floating focus design for improved performance at close distances despite short minimum focus distance of 0.45m
+Vintage-inspired depth-of-field scale with color-changing mechanical indicator adds aesthetic appeal and functionality
+Compact, lightweight design (~325g) makes it ideal for travel and street photography while balancing build quality
+Clickable/de-clickable aperture ring suits both photography and silent video operation
Worth Knowing
−Soft, low-contrast rendering at maximum aperture (f/1.4-f/2) creates vintage aesthetic that requires stopping down to f/2.8+ for optimized sharpness
−Fully manual focus lens without autofocus or electronic contacts—slower focusing compared to modern AF lenses, especially on mirrorless bodies
−Notable vignetting at f/1.4 (2.6 EV) requires lens hood attachment; prone to lens flare when shooting backlit scenarios
−Infinity focus lock requires deliberate disengagement to refocus closer, which some users find cumbersome despite its vintage charm
